WinX DVD Author

WinX DVD Author

WinX DVD Author is a free DVD burning software that allows you to convert and burn videos to DVDs. It supports a wide range of video formats and allows editing features like trimming, cropping, adding subtitles, menus, and chapters.

DVD Flick

DVD Flick

DVD Flick is a free, open source DVD authoring application for Windows that allows you to turn video files into professional-looking DVDs that can play on standard DVD players. It supports most common video formats.

DVD Flick Features

  1. Converts and burns various video files into DVD format
  2. Supports most common video formats like AVI, WMV, MOV, MP4, etc.
  3. Allows creating DVD menus with background music and images
  4. Has basic editing features like trimming videos
  5. Can add multiple videos and audio tracks
  6. Supports multiple languages and subtitles
  7. Free and open source

Cons

Limited editing capabilities compared to paid software

No advanced authoring features like multi-angle videos

Basic menus and themes

Windows only
